After My Sister Died, I Became Her
After My Sister Died, I Became Her Plot:
Lin Wan is a ruthless "Iron Lady" in investment banking, estranged from her sister Lin Xiaotang—a soft, cute Hanfu live-streamer—for years due to a misunderstanding. When Xiaotang dies in an accidental fall, Lin Wan finds anomalies in her belongings: Xiaotang's live-stream account was maliciously reported, collaborations terminated abruptly, and there were anonymous threat messages. To uncover the truth, Lin Wan is forced to "become Xiaotang": learning to wear Hanfu, imitating her soft tone. But during her first live stream, she meets Xiaotang's "mysterious boyfriend" Gu Yanchuan—the cold, unapproachable heir to a business empire she'd met at a business banquet. Gu Yanchuan sees through her disguise instantly: "You're not Xiaotang. Your fingertips have calluses from holding a pen for years." Panicked, Lin Wan is surprised when Gu Yanchuan hands her hot cocoa: "I've been waiting for you—Lin Wan, the one who makes opponents tremble at the negotiation table." It turns out Gu Yanchuan had fallen for her at the banquet, and Xiaotang had secretly helped him collect info on Lin Wan's preferences. When Lin Wan uses her skills to reveal Xiaotang's death was a competitor's plot, she not only avenges her sister but also regains the family and love she once missed, with Gu Yanchuan by her side.

Back to 1959: The Heartbreak System Rewrites Life
Modern office worker Zhou Zhou, haunted by the unspoken regret of her grandfather's death, accidentally binds to the "Heartbreak System" and travels back to 1959—a time when her grandfather was still a tough, unemotional steelworker. Her mission? Make the man who "never cries" shed a tear, or stay stuck in the past forever. But when her attempt to please him with chocolate gets labeled "speculation", her mushy love letter is crumpled into a ball, and she secretly saves food coupons for the osmanthus cake his late wife loved, she uncovers the tenderness beneath his hard exterior: he writes unsent letters to his wife at night, gives his only steamed bun to a neighbor's kid, and even hid his terminal illness from Zhou Zhou in the present to avoid missing her wedding. Just as she finally makes her grandfather's eyes redden with his late wife's old scarf, the system suddenly alerts: "Mission incomplete"—turns out, the one who really needs to "break" is Zhou Zhou herself, and her decade-long misunderstanding that "Grandpa didn't love me".
